Transaction 0085377f62c76f2d862a164f659654a7bf21eb3e171abc152834eb2fa6c8a13d
1 Input
1 Output
-
0085377f62c76f2d862a164f659654a7bf21eb3e171abc152834eb2fa6c8a13d:0
- value
- 1087972
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ad457cd486e58630705a5ddf681787de5806bd8 OP_EQUAL
- address
- 39yH7f4pZjaKVM9WmwABp76Kvc5uivYGex